javascript笔记

每天在项目遇到的一些问题整理

如何用JS实现播放时间问题

//如何用JS实现播放时间的实时获取 
ado.addEventListener("timeupdate",function(){
    console.log(this.currentTime);
  });

  ado.addEventListener("loadedmetadata",function(){
    this.play();
  });
//到指定的时间点播放
  ado.addEventListener("onplay",function(){
    this.currentTime=5
  });
//判断audio是否已经播放完毕 ended
  ado.addEventListener("ended",function(){
   //do somethings
  });

//提示该视频已准备好开始播放:
audio|video.addEventListener("canplay", function()
  {
  //SomeJavaScriptCode
  }
);

<p>点击按钮获取或者设置播放的音频音量。</p>
<button onclick="getVolume()" type="button">查看音量?</button>
<button onclick="setHalfVolume()" type="button">设置音量为 0.2</button>
<button onclick="setFullVolume()" type="button">设置音量为 1.0</button>
<script>
var x = document.getElementById("myAudio");
function getVolume(){ 
    alert(x.volume);
} 
function setHalfVolume(){ 
    x.volume = 0.2;
} 
function setFullVolume(){ 
    x.volume = 1.0;
} 
</script>
最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• Android 自定义View的各种姿势1 Activity的显示之ViewRootImpl详解 Activity...
    passiontim阅读 175,776评论 25 709
  • 发现 关注 消息 iOS 第三方库、插件、知名博客总结 作者大灰狼的小绵羊哥哥关注 2017.06.26 09:4...
    肇东周阅读 14,245评论 4 61
  • 你可能不知道的一些JavaScript 奇淫巧技 这里记录一下以前学习各种书籍和文章里边出现的JS的小技巧,...
    Yance阅读 1,885评论 0 0
  • 如今青年和壮年猝死的新闻比比皆是,但昨天多年同事猝死的消息还是让我迟迟无法接受。死亡已经悄悄袭击了我们身边人。 因...
    米素文阅读 3,599评论 1 9
  • 有一个灵魂它喜欢新鲜感 可是它能图另一个灵魂的新鲜感很久很久 有一个灵魂 现在只想荡着双脚 双手摆头 看着天花板 ...
    李几阅读 1,833评论 0 2